Following the premiere, Ryan Simpkins was back promoting ''Fear Street'' and her stylist Amanda Lim posted her look on instagram this evening(July 1st).
Rocking an all black ensemble, she wore a CHRISTOPHER KANE PRE-FALL 2020 crystal tie-neck shirt and a layered lace & crepe peplum skirt. Although I prefer the look book's styling, I still think Ryan pulled this 80's inspired ensemble off.
The skirt is a little too puffy but its not a bad look. However I'm on the fence about the matching JIMMY CHOO lace booties. I think that she should have gone with a simpler style that was less focus pulling. An up-do with side swept bangs and smokey eyes finished up her look.
